Successful engagement with the public can benefit research, researchers and the public – but how do you go about demonstrating this change? Evaluation of engagement doesn’t just help us demonstrate the value of our PE initiatives but can help bring us closer to our audiences by giving the public a strong clear voice. This workshop will guide you through the best evaluation processes showing you When, Why and crucially How to use evaluation to give you reliable and clear data. Join this course to learn how to:
- Demonstrate success to funders;
- Record Impact for REF;
- Improve your processes;
- Have a better understanding of the people you are connecting with.
The group session will be followed by the opportunity for a one-to-one 15-minute session with the trainer where you can discuss your ideas and questions, and get project specific help.

Provide an overview of the purposes, uses and limitations of evaluation.
Following this workshop, participants will be able to:
- Apply event-appropriate evaluation methods in multiple scenarios
- Prepare useful, answerable and relevant evaluation questions
- Devise and deliver your own evaluation plan
- Interpret and report evaluation data
